Green Future

I happened to acquire a number of 16×20 canvases on sale the other day. They were just sitting there by my art table for a while until I had this strong urge to paint something GREEN. We don’t have much that’s green around here at the moment – the hills are all brown and beige, the live oak trees are all a DARK green, but not a LUSH green, and the leaves now falling off the black walnut tree out front are all yellow. So, I couldn’t wait for the rainy season to start and bring everything back to life – I needed green NOW – heh.

Green Future Acrylic Painting - Prints Available

The title seemed to be Green Future – in the optimistic ecological sense, but also in the immediate “the rainy season is coming” way. I like how the abstract style can really highlight color schemes and not distract with left-brain-recognizable objects.

Parabolic Mirror Lives!

After much time off from posting to his site as a personal blog, John has rebirthed his domain as something he’s been wanting to do for a long time. Actually, he originally bought the domain name, Parabolic Mirror, (many years ago) as a sort of spoof of things like the Daily Mirror tabloid, but the original idea for it didn’t come about right away. Creative ideas have their own schedule, apparently!

In any case, it’s now officially a site for news and political satire! Not just making fun of politics and news, but creating parody stories that step sideways while still incorporating the actual news in funny ways. 🙂 He’s got a few posts there already, so stop by if you’d like a good chuckle: Parabolic Mirror. Solomon the Cat

My sister and brother-in-law had to put their cat Solomon to sleep today. A number of years ago they had started taking care of him when he was basically being neglected by his original family and just roaming around the neighborhood all the time. Finally, my sister asked the original family if they could just adopt him completely and they said yes, so Solomon moved in!

They gave him a really good home and lots of wonderful attention, which I’m sure Solomon really appreciated in his own crazy cat way. Cheers, Solomon!
